John Walter Peters' Obituary
John Walter Peters, age 50, of Holiday, FL passed away suddenly at his home. John was born in Parma, OH to Margie (nee Reed) and John J. Peters.
John worked as a self-employed contractor for many years, before retiring in 2023. He has been a resident of Florida for over 10 years, after moving from Cleveland.
John was known for his love of animals. He was also very involved with Hanger Clinic, where he established a deep lasting friendship with Matt and Wendy Brewer. Matt and Wendy worked with John and helped him realize that life was worth living with his disability.
John is survived by his parents, Marjorie Jeanne (nee Reed) and John Joseph Peters, sister, Liz (Brian) Fox, niece Emma, nephews Luke, Colin and Ryan, many aunts, uncles and close friends.
A Funeral Mass will be held on Monday, February 9, 2026 at 11AM at St. Julie Billiart Catholic Church 5500 Lear Nagle Rd, North Ridgeville, OH 44039. Father Isidore Munishi will officiate. Interment will follow at St Joseph Cemetery in Avon.
